How to Remove Stickers From Metal - The Spruce In a small bowl or bucket, mix two cups of very warm water and a few drops of dishwashing liquid. Stir well to mix. Dip an old, soft cloth in the soapy mixture and dab lightly at the sticker, then use an old credit card or rubber spatula to gently scrape away the adhesive. Wipe away what's left of the sticker and residue from the metal surface.

How to Remove Stickers from Wood, Metal, Glass, & More Here's how to remove stickers from plastic: Fill a bowl with warm, soapy water. Soak a cotton swab with cooking oil and saturate the sticker. Let sit for about 5 minutes. Rinse in the bowl of water. Peel the sticker off the plastic. If your item is too big to put in a bowl, don't worry! How To Remove Glue On Plastic Container? Recycling Quandary: What To Do About Labels on Plastic? You should remove plastic film labels from containers before recycling the container. In nearly all cases, the label itself should be disposed of as garbage. Plastic Bags. In rare cases, a plastic film label may be labeled as #2 or #4 plastic, in which case you can treat it like other plastic films, such as grocery bags (#2) and produce bags (#4).

How to Remove Glue From Plastic - Cleaning Adhesives from Surfaces Using Vinegar to Remove Glue From Plastic. Apply some vinegar to a cloth and lay the cloth over the glue. Leave the cloth there for about 15 to 30 minutes and then clean the solution and the glue off. The glue will have been loosened so will come off with ease, but you can also use a toothbrush to scrape it off.

How to Easily Remove Sticky Labels From Glass Jars Add 1-2 tablespoons dish soap and ½ cup of white vinegar. Submerge jars in water and let them soak for 20-30 minutes. Remove jars from water and easily remove labels. For sticky label glue that won't come off, mix together equal parts oil and baking soda in a small bowl, then rub onto label glue and scrub with a dish rag or scrub brush.
